Step‑by‑Step Instructions for Cheesy Dill Pickle Quesadilla
- Begin by patting the dill pickle slices dry with paper towels to remove excess moisture.
- Place a griddle pan over medium-high heat, allowing it to preheat for about 3–5 minutes.
- Lay a wheat tortilla flat on a clean surface. Sprinkle half of the dill havarti cheese on one half of the tortilla, followed by a layer of the dried dill pickle slices.
- Fold the tortilla over to cover the filling, then carefully place it onto the heated griddle.
- Using a spatula, carefully flip the quesadilla over and cook the other side until both sides are evenly browned and the cheese is fully melted.
- Once cooked, remove the quesadilla from the griddle and let it rest for 1-2 minutes before slicing it into wedges.
- Enjoy your Cheesy Dill Pickle Quesadilla hot, with your choice of dipping sauce.
